+static
+int _generate_filter_bytecode(struct run_as_data *data,
+               struct run_as_ret *ret_value) {
+       int ret = 0;
+       const char *filter_expression = NULL;
+       struct filter_parser_ctx *ctx = NULL;
+
+       ret_value->_error = false;
+
+       filter_expression = data->u.generate_filter_bytecode.filter_expression;
+
+       if (lttng_strnlen(filter_expression, LTTNG_FILTER_MAX_LEN - 1) == LTTNG_FILTER_MAX_LEN - 1) {
+               ret_value->_error = true;
+               ret = -1;
+               goto end;
+       }
+
+       ret = filter_parser_ctx_create_from_filter_expression(filter_expression, &ctx);
+       if (ret < 0) {
+               ret_value->_error = true;
+               ret = -1;
+               goto end;
+       }
+
+       DBG("Size of bytecode generated: %u bytes.",
+                       bytecode_get_len(&ctx->bytecode->b));
+
+       /* Copy the lttng_bytecode_filter object to the return structure. */
+       memcpy(ret_value->u.generate_filter_bytecode.bytecode,
+                       &ctx->bytecode->b,
+                       sizeof(ctx->bytecode->b) +
+                                       bytecode_get_len(&ctx->bytecode->b));
+
+end:
+       if (ctx) {
+               filter_bytecode_free(ctx);
+               filter_ir_free(ctx);
+               filter_parser_ctx_free(ctx);
+       }
+
+       return ret;
+}

+LTTNG_HIDDEN
+int run_as_generate_filter_bytecode(const char *filter_expression,
+               uid_t uid,
+               gid_t gid,
+               struct lttng_filter_bytecode **bytecode)
+{
+       int ret;
+       struct run_as_data data = {};
+       struct run_as_ret run_as_ret = {};
+       const struct lttng_filter_bytecode *view_bytecode = NULL;
+       struct lttng_filter_bytecode *local_bytecode = NULL;
+
+       DBG3("generate_filter_bytecode() from expression=\"%s\" for uid %d and gid %d",
+                       filter_expression, (int) uid, (int) gid);
+
+       ret = lttng_strncpy(data.u.generate_filter_bytecode.filter_expression, filter_expression,
+                       sizeof(data.u.generate_filter_bytecode.filter_expression));
+       if (ret) {
+               goto error;
+       }
+
+       run_as(RUN_AS_GENERATE_FILTER_BYTECODE, &data, &run_as_ret, uid, gid);
+       errno = run_as_ret._errno;
+       if (run_as_ret._error) {
+               ret = -1;
+               goto error;
+       }
+
+       view_bytecode = (const struct lttng_filter_bytecode *) run_as_ret.u.generate_filter_bytecode.bytecode;
+
+       local_bytecode = zmalloc(sizeof(*local_bytecode) + view_bytecode->len);
+       if (!local_bytecode) {
+               ret = -ENOMEM;
+               goto error;
+       }
+
+       memcpy(local_bytecode, run_as_ret.u.generate_filter_bytecode.bytecode,
+                       sizeof(*local_bytecode) + view_bytecode->len);
+       *bytecode = local_bytecode;
+error:
+       return ret;
+}
